Santander Bank

Java Software Engineer (Málaga) - Santander Digital Services

Spain
Docker Git Microservices Java Angular Node.js API SQL
Description
Java Software Engineer (Málaga) - Santander Digital Services

Country: Spain

Job Description

SANTANDER DIGITAL SERVICES is looking for a Java Software Engineer based in one of our Hubs in Málaga.

WHY YOU SHOULD CONSIDER THIS OPPORTUNITY

At Santander (www.santander.com) we are key players in the transformation of the financial sector. Do you want to join us?

Santander Digital Services (SDS) is the team of technology and operations at Santander. We are convinced of the importance of technology that is aligned with the requirements of the business and that out work not only brings value to users, people and communities but also fosters individual creativity. Our team of over 7,000 people in 8 countries (Spain, Portugal, Poland, UK, USA, Mexico, Chile and Brazil) develops and/or implements financial solutions across a broad spectrum of technologies (including Blockchain, Big Data and Angular among others) on all kinds of on-premises and cloud-based platforms.

UK Tower is the Santander UK Nearshoring strategy vehicle in Santander Digital Services located in Spain, to provide technology workforce and services directly to Santander UK that will work together and for UK Technology teams.

Santander is proud of being an organization where there are equal opportunities regardless of gender identity, culture and disability. Our mission is to contribute to help more people and business prosper. We embrace a strong risk culture and all of our professionals at all levels are expected to take a proactive and responsible approach toward risk management.

WHAT YOU WILL BE DOING

As a Java Software Engineer you will have the opportunity to work in a highly dynamic and inventive environment.

We value delivering high-quality products that meet the needs of our customers. To this end, we are seeking candidates who will oversee the entire software development lifecycle, from planning to deployment and beyond.

We need someone like you to help us in different fronts: 

  • Taking responsibility of the software delivery by ensuring quality and scope expectations are met.

  • Developing user stories working solo or pairing with a colleague .

  • Discussing functional and technical solutions with the different stakeholders in the business, UX designers, architecture, and engineering managers to ensure US are refined and understood at the correct level.

  • Write the automated testing required to ensure your stories meet the criteria to be considered “Done”.

  • Ensuring delivered solutions are developed under DevOps practices and latest technology trends.

  • Keeping the solutions delivered running healthy in production minimising incidents and maximising quality of service.

  • A software engineer who takes pride in their craftsmanship and in the results that they deliver.

EXPERIENCE

  • +5-7 years of related experience.

EDUCATION

  • University degree in technology, preferably in computer science.

SKILLS & KNOWLEDGE

  • Java.

  • Extensive knowledge of working with distributed infrastructure systems and client-server architectures.

  • Back-end technologies such as Springboot, Node JS, Mongo DB, Java, npm packaging, RESTful APIs. Experience in IBM API Connect and StrongLoop is a plus .

  • Excellent working knowledge of both SQL and NoSQL databases.

  • Experience of using agile methodologies embedding TDD (test-driven development) and BDD as part of development lifecycle.

  • Experience with API development (REST).

  • Knowledge of continuous Integration and continuous delivery using Jenkins and the Nexus repository manager.

  • Knowledge of Docker, Git, GitHub, Openshift and MicroServices Architecture.

OTHER INFORMATION 

  • English at least C1. 

  • Availability to travel if needed.

If you want to know more about us, visit our website https://www.betechwithsantander.com/en/home

Santander Bank
Santander Bank
Banking Finance Financial Services

0 applies

34 views

There are more than 50,000 engineering jobs:

Subscribe to membership and unlock all jobs

Engineering Jobs

50,000+ jobs from 4,500+ well-funded companies

Updated Daily

New jobs are added every day as companies post them

Refined Search

Use filters like skill, location, etc to narrow results

Become a member

🥳🥳🥳 241 happy customers and counting...

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.

Cancel anytime / Money-back guarantee

Wall of love from fellow engineers